I have a car charger from Gomadic with a tip for my Verizon XV6700 phone. I noticed that it has the same kind of plug on the end as the connector on the back of my Garmin Legend CX. Would I ruin something by trying to see if this will power the Garmin? :P

Posted

Most of the newer Garmins will receive power through the USB port, and AFAIK, that is the only way the news eTrexes will receive power.

 

Isn't USB a standard? Shouldn't a USB power cord for one device work for all other devices?

Posted

USB is standard, but depending on the quality of the cig adapter, you might have slightly more or less juice than a USB connection from your PC would have. Some devices can handle this variation with no problem. Others might have pretty severe problems, I would think.

Posted

Any car adapter with mini-USB (5 volt) would work.

It'll charge your rechargeable GPS devices.

 

For 60CSx it would just power it.

Posted

Any car adapter with mini-USB (5 volt) would work.

Well, yes, mostly. The spec is 5vDC. Whether it'll fry your device depends on the manufacturer's interpretation and implementation of "5 volts." Do they take it to mean 5v +/- 0.5, or +/- 0.1 ??? I'd think as long as it has a brand you recognize and trust it's probably OK.

Posted

I worry about the Blackberry chargers with my GPS unit. I know that the current from the USB on my laptop is not enough to power the Blackberry unless I install the drivers from RIM to the computer. Also my Motorola and Garmin chargers won't power the Blackberry so I hesitate to use the Blackberry charger on the other units.
